Is the Food Better in Lagos or Bordeaux? Which Destination has the Best Restaurants?

Lagos
Bordeaux

Bordeaux is a must-visit destination for its restaurant scene. Also, Lagos is still popular, but not quite as popular for its local flavors and cuisine.

Eat your way through Bordeaux, as it has many local or world renowned restaurants to choose from. Both food and wine are a major draw to this culinary city, which is known for its pastries and rich flavors. Popular local dishes include grilled duck, duck foie gras, and canelés.

Lagos has a huge number of terrific restaurants. The city offers some of the best food in the Algarve. The old town has plenty of restaurants that are both affordable and high quality. Seafood is the obvious choice, but you'll also find tapas, paellas, and local dishes such as cataplana (a seafood and chorizo stew). Most restaurants serve up a local fish of the day as well as prawns and other seafood items.

Is Lagos or Bordeaux Better for Beaches?

Lagos
Bordeaux

Lagos is a world-class destination for the beach. However, Bordeaux is not a beach destination.

Travelers come from around the world to visit the beaches in Lagos. The beaches are long, flat and sandy with beautifully dramatic rock formations. The largest beach in the area is Meia Praia and arguably one of the best beaches is Praia Dona Ana. For convenience, Praia da Batata is the closest beach to town. Praia de Porto de Mós is one of the more quiet beaches, but it's still along a bus line. For beautiful nature head to either Praia dos Estudantes or Praia dos Pinheiros.

Bordeaux is not a beach destination.

Is Lagos or Bordeaux Better for Hiking?

Lagos
Bordeaux

Lagos is a great destination for its hiking experiences. However, Bordeaux is not a hiking destination.

You'll find a nice variety of hiking trails around Lagos. The city makes an excellent base for exploring some of the nearby hikes and walks. Favorite places to hike include the famous Ponte de Piedade Trail, which is the last part of the multi-day Fisherman's Trail. It takes you by many beautiful rock formations and scenic viewpoints. Another scenic hike is The Alvor Walkways, which is a series of boardwalks through sand dunes.

Bordeaux is not a hiking destination.

Is Lagos or Bordeaux Better for Families?

Lagos
Bordeaux

Lagos is a world-class destination for its family-friendly activities. Also, Bordeaux is still popular, but not quite as popular for its kid-friendly activities.

As it has a large number of activities for kids, Lagos is a very family-friendly destination. You can spend days hanging out on the beautiful beaches, but there are so many other activities that the whole family will enjoy. Explore the caves in kayaks, take surfing lessons, head for the zoo, or go dolphin watching. There are also plenty of playgrounds and kid-friendly restaurants around town.

Bordeaux offers lots of family activities. The city has a number of parks and playgrounds as well as museums, including a kid's science museum. Kids also enjoy splashing around in the Miroir d’eau, which is the world's largest water mirror.
